This program is a four-year degreeコース with a built-in foundation year (Year 0). It's designed for those who haven't met the traditional entry requirements for university courses or want to gain foundational knowledge before embarking on a three-year degree.
Objectives:
- Equip students with the knowledge and skills needed for careers in the computer networking and cyber security industry.
- Expose students to the importance of network security, threats to network infrastructure, and mitigation strategies.
- Develop technical expertise in network security through Cisco Networking Academy and Palo Alto Academy certifications.
- Enable graduates to pursue postgraduate study to enhance their career prospects.
Program Description:
Year 0 focuses on fundamental concepts like cyber security, programming, logic, communications, and mathematics. These crucial skills prepare students for the following three years. Years 1, 2, and 3 entail exploring core modules (Cyber Security Fundamentals, Communications Engineering, Network Operating Systems, etc.) alongside specialized tracks (Cyber Security Operations, Network Security 1 & 2, Next Gen Firewalls, etc.). Students can choose options like Ethical Hacking, IoT Systems and Security, and Broadband Systems 2 to personalize their learning journey.

Entry requirements
In addition to the university's standard entry requirements, you must have achieved at least one A Level from a recognised exam board, or a minimum of 32 UCAS points from an equivalent Level 3 qualification, such as a BTEC Subsidiary/National Diploma/BTEC Extended Diploma. Additionally, you must hold a GCSE in English Language and Mathematics at grade C/4 or above, or equivalent, like Functional Skills at Level 2. If you meet the UCAS points criteria but obtained a D/3 in English and/or Maths at GCSE, you may be offered a university test in these areas.
English language requirements
To study a degree at London Met, you must be able to demonstrate proficiency in the English language. If you require a student visa (previously referred to as Tier 4), you may be required to provide the results of a Secure English Language Test (SELT) such as Academic IELTS. This course requires you to meet our standard requirements and achieve an overall IELTS score of 6.0, with a minimum of 5.5 in each component or equivalent.
